I have a Tekin RX8 gen 1 and a ROC 412 3100kv. The motor is brand new. The ESC has not been used in over a year. Well I thought I would update the software before I installed the speed control and it took it. I wired it up. I have reprogramed the speed control at least 10 times with the new firmware and the older firmware.

I can't get the speed control to calibrate. None of the light turn on on the ESC. If I plug in my castle speed and old motor it works fine.

If I turn on the speed control with it not plugged into the receiver it will chime and light up the light.

If I plug it into the receiver and turn it on- no light on the receiver no lights.

I have double checked the wires on the speed control and motor. Unplugged the sensor wires-unplugged the fan-unplugged the servo-

The problem was the internal BEC was bad. I installed a new BEC and fix it. The old servo must have shorted out the internal BEC.

Internal bec tends not to like any servo pulling good amount of amps. This is typical of high tq/ high amps being pulled from internal bec. This is why external bec should be used every time on a crawler. Just a fyi....... on all of my race rigs I use external bec just in the event there may end up with the same issue.
 
Well I dove it a couple of times and the ESC stopped working again. This time when I plug it in the servo works, but no beeps from the ESC and no light. I double checked the wires at the speed control and the motor. They are good. I guess I need to send the RX8 in for repairs.
